Elastic Scattering ofHe3byHe4from 17.8 to 30.0 MeV

Abstract
Differential cross sections for the elastic scattering of He3 by He4 have been measured from 21.9 to 155.0° (c.m.) at He3 energies of 17.79, 19.99, 22.00, 23.98, 26.00, 28.00, and 30.00 MeV (lab). The relative standard deviations of the data are typically less than 2.5%, but become larger at angles where the cross section is very low. In addition to relative errors, the over-all error includes a standard deviation of 3% in the cross-section scale. The measurements are compared with theoretical calculations using the resonating-group method in the one-channel approximation. Differences between theory and experiment can be qualitatively understood as being caused mainly by the omission of reaction channels in the theory.
